#7dc014 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7dc014 is composed of 49% red, 75.3%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 83.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 41.6%. #7dc014 color hex could be obtained by blending #faff28 with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#7dc014 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7dc014 has RGB values of R:125, G:192,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 8241172.

Shades and Tints of #7dc014
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090e01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7dc014
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6e66 is the less saturated color, while #81d004 is the most saturated one.
